Every year, more than a million people choose to holiday on the beautiful Wadden Islands, attracted by the beach, the sea, the Wadden and the tranquillity. The unique island feeling is unforgettable. But what happens when something goes wrong? Who rescues you from the sea, or transports you from the beach or from the dunes to the ambulance or even to the shore?
On the Wadden Islands, the Royal Dutch Rescue Society (KNRM) is always close by and relevant to everyone, including you.
Meet the KNRM lifeguards on Ameland beach during one of the open evenings. Get explanations on safe swimming, the equipment and see a rescue demonstration.
